Stranger of Paradise Final Fantasy Origin Will Feature More Party Members

The full release of Stranger of Paradise Final Fantasy Origin will have more party members available to the player. This information was revealed during a recent interview with Famitsu. Director Daisuke Inoue shared this information, along with other gameplay details regarding Stranger of Paradise Final Fantasy Origin. This also includes how players will be able to customize their party members. [Thanks, Famitsu!]

As mentioned previously, players will have more party members available than the ones currently in the Stranger of Paradise Final Fantasy Origin demo. However, while other characters can join your party you can only ever a party limit of three characters. Players can switch these characters out.

Additionally, players will be able to change the equipment of their party members. However, there is a stipulation to this. Certain characters can only use certain types of equipment. Jack on the other hand will be able to equip any and all weapon and armor sets. Inoue also shared that a total of eight different weapon types will be available in Stranger of Paradise Final Fantasy Origin.

Stranger of Paradise Final Fantasy Origin will come to the PS4, PS5, Xbox One, Xbox Series X, and PC in 2022. The Trial Version demo available on the PS5 until June 24, 2021.
